Adam Humphries catches one of two targets against New Orleans

Adam Humphries caught one of his two targets for 11 yards against the Saints on Saturday afternoon. Humphries caught a touchdown in Week 15 against Dallas, but has been targeted five times or less in each of his last four games. He has 45 catches for 528 yards and two touchdowns this season.

Fantasy Impact:

Humphries was a sleeper pick at the earlier part of the season, but has not topped 50 yards receiving in a game since October 30. He has had three catches of 30 yards or further, and is the punt returner, but Mike Evans and Cameron Brate appear to be getting all of the looks in the red zone. The Panthers, Tampa Bay's last 2016 opponent, rank 23rd against fantasy WR and Humphries had one catch on two targets in a Week 5 win over Carolina.
